About this House

A great 1 bedroom 1 bath upstairs unit, close to shopping, the library and the Pearl Street Mall. Coin operated laundry on site. One assigned parking spot is available.

Managed by Blue Skies Property Management. Please call or email Sam with questions and you will be given the on-site manager's contact information to schedule a showing.

1. THE PROPSPECTIVE TENANT HAS THE RIGHT TO PROVIDE TO THE LANDLORD A PORTABLE TENANT SCREENING REPORT, AS DEFINED IN SECTION 38-12-902, COLORADO REVISED STATUTES; AND
2. IF THE PROPSPECTIVE TENANT PROVIDES THE LANDLORD WITH A PORTABLE TENANT SCREENING REPORT, THE LANDLORD IS PROHIBITED FROM:
CHARGING THE PROSPECTIVE TENANT A RENTAL APPLICATION FEE; OR
CHARGING THE PROPSECTIVE TENANT A FEE FOR THE LANDLORD TO ACCESS OR USE THE PORTABLE TENANT SCREENING REPORT

Tenant pays Xcel Energy and internet. Owner pays water, sewer, trash, yard care and snow removal.
